Bright mango and lime blend with chili heat, topped with kiwi, granola, coconut and chia for a revitalizing breakfast.
# What You'll Need:
→ Smoothie Base
01 - 2 cups frozen mango chunks
02 - 1 ripe banana
03 - 1/2 cup coconut milk or almond milk
04 - Juice of 1 lime
05 - 1/2 teaspoon chili powder, adjust to taste
06 - 1 tablespoon honey or agave syrup (optional)
→ Toppings
07 - 1/2 fresh mango, diced
08 - 1 kiwi, peeled and sliced
09 - 2 tablespoons granola (use gluten-free if required)
10 - 1 tablespoon unsweetened shredded coconut
11 - 1 tablespoon chia seeds
12 - Fresh mint leaves (optional)
13 - Zest of 1 lime and a pinch of chili flakes for garnish
# How To Make It:
01 - Measure and assemble frozen mango, banana, milk, lime juice, chili powder and honey or agave; peel and slice kiwi and dice fresh mango for topping.
02 - Combine frozen mango, banana, milk, lime juice, chili powder and sweetener in a blender and process until creamy and uniformly smooth, scraping down the sides once if needed.
03 - Pour the blended mixture evenly into two serving bowls, using a spatula to transfer all of the base.
04 - Artistically arrange diced mango, kiwi slices, granola, shredded coconut, chia seeds and mint over each bowl for contrast in texture and flavor.
05 - Finish with a sprinkle of lime zest and a light pinch of chili flakes to taste, then serve immediately to preserve creaminess.
